From witnessing mangoes rot on her family's farm in Makueni to becoming one of Kenya's Business Daily Top 40 Under 40 Women 2026, Faith Mumo's journey is a powerful reminder that some of the world's greatest innovations begin with solving problems close to home.

Growing up in Makueni County, Faith experienced first-hand the devastating impact of post-harvest losses. Every harvest season, farmers worked tirelessly only to lose significant portions of their produce before it could reach the market. Rather than accepting this as the norm, she saw an opportunity to create change.

Driven by a passion for agriculture and innovation, Faith pursued a Bachelor of Science in Aquaculture and Fisheries, equipping herself with the technical knowledge needed to develop practical solutions for farmers. She co-founded **Iviani Farm**, a social enterprise dedicated to reducing food loss, promoting climate-smart agriculture, and creating sustainable livelihood opportunities across East Africa.

What started with addressing post-harvest losses has grown into an integrated agribusiness that combines mango value addition with climate-smart aquaculture. Through innovative fish farming systems that recycle water and use sensor technology to monitor water quality and fish health, Iviani Farm is helping farmers increase productivity while adapting to climate change.

Today, the enterprise has expanded its impact beyond Kenya, supporting farmers across Kenya, Uganda, and Tanzania. Iviani Farm has helped thousands of smallholder farmers improve productivity and incomes, trained tens of thousands of people in agribusiness and climate-smart farming practices, and developed value-added agricultural products that reach both local and international markets.
